Who Is Andrew Huberman?
Andrew Huberman, PhD, is a neuroscientist and professor at Stanford University School of Medicine. You may recognize him from the Huberman Lab Podcast, where he explains neuroscience findings on brain function, sleep, and supplementation. For more than 20 years, Huberman has researched neural regeneration, neuroplasticity, and brain optimization methods, with his work appearing in journals like Nature and Science. He often shares practical strategies for brain health—such as optimal magnesium threonate dosages—backed by scientific evidence and clinical studies. By focusing on science-based advice, Huberman offers actionable recommendations for improving cognitive performance and mental well-being.

Why Andrew Huberman Recommends Magnesium Threonate
Andrew Huberman recommends magnesium threonate based on its unique ability to elevate brain magnesium levels. You gain the most cognitive benefit from magnesium when it readily crosses the blood-brain barrier, a property seen in magnesium threonate but not in other forms like magnesium citrate or glycinate, according to PubMed studies.
You support memory, learning, and overall neural plasticity when you increase brain magnesium. Clinical trials, including a 2016 study in the journal Neuron, show that daily magnesium threonate supplementation can improve short- and long-term memory in adults.
You can also optimize your sleep by choosing magnesium threonate. Huberman highlights that this form aids relaxation and reduces brain hyperactivity, as discussed in his podcast and related research in Frontiers in Aging Neuroscience. You may notice improvements in sleep onset and sleep depth if you target brain magnesium levels.
Huberman references specific dosage protocols, often between 1,000–2,000 mg magnesium threonate per day, to align with research-backed efficacy and minimize digestive side effects (sources: Neuron 2016, Huberman Lab Podcast 2022).
Understanding Magnesium Threonate
Magnesium threonate’s structure enables it to deliver magnesium directly to your brain. This property sets it apart from other magnesium supplements and underlies its growing use for cognitive support.
What Sets Magnesium Threonate Apart?
Magnesium threonate excels at increasing brain magnesium concentrations, unlike other forms including oxide or citrate. Researchers developed it specifically to cross the blood-brain barrier efficiently, enhancing delivery where your brain needs it for synaptic functioning. Animal and human studies cited by Dr. Andrew Huberman emphasize this absorption mechanism, linking threonate to cognitive gains that other magnesium variants can’t replicate. Supplemental forms such as citrate or glycinate show limited impact on neural tissue, making threonate unique for addressing memory and mental clarity.
Potential Benefits for Brain Health
Magnesium threonate supports memory formation, learning capacity, and synaptic plasticity. According to clinical trials including Liu et al. (2016) published in "Neuron," daily use of magnesium threonate improved both short- and long-term memory in adults. Users report easier recall, sharper focus, and fewer episodes of mental fatigue. Dr. Huberman highlights its role in sleep enhancement by calming neural activity and promoting deeper rest, based on real-world evidence and double-blind placebo-controlled studies. People looking to optimize cognitive flexibility, stress resilience, or sleep quality select magnesium threonate for its targeted brain effects.

Andrew Huberman’s Recommended Magnesium Threonate Dose
Andrew Huberman consistently cites magnesium threonate as a superior form for brain health, mainly for its absorption and targeted cognitive effects. Research behind his recommendations connects optimal dosing with measurable improvements in memory, attention, and sleep quality.
Typical Dosage Guidelines
Typical daily magnesium threonate dosages referenced by Huberman range from 1,000 mg to 2,000 mg. You often see this divided into two or three smaller doses to enhance absorption and reduce potential digestive discomfort. Clinical studies like "Abraham, M. et al., Neuron, 2010," align with these amounts and demonstrate efficacy for cognitive enhancement and synaptic plasticity in adults. Individual responses may vary based on age, current magnesium status, and specific cognitive goals.
When to Take Magnesium Threonate
Optimal results from magnesium threonate arise when you time doses about 1–2 hours before sleep or later in the evening. This strategy supports both brain magnesium uptake and the promotion of deep, restorative sleep. Some users, especially those seeking daytime cognitive sharpness, split their intake—taking one portion in the late afternoon and the other before bed—per Huberman’s typical usage pattern.

Possible Side Effects and Considerations
Possible side effects of magnesium threonate usually impact your digestive system. Instances include bloating, loose stools, or mild gastrointestinal discomfort, especially over 2,000 mg per day. Lower dosages or splitting the total intake into smaller amounts helps minimize these effects according to clinical reviews in "Frontiers in Aging Neuroscience".
Drug interactions sometimes occur with magnesium supplements. For example, antibiotics like tetracyclines, or bisphosphonates prescribed for osteoporosis, may show decreased absorption when taken with magnesium. Medical consultation determines proper timing to avoid these interactions.
Kidney function influences your magnesium threonate tolerance. Impaired kidney health potentially raises your magnesium blood levels, which rarely causes serious problems in healthy adults, but medical supervision becomes crucial for anyone with existing kidney conditions.
Pregnancy and breastfeeding lack robust data for magnesium threonate use. Guidance from a healthcare provider ensures safety for both mother and child in these circumstances.
Sensitivity to sleep-promoting effects differs. Some users report deeper sleep, while others may experience drowsiness or vivid dreams if taken in the daytime.
Tips for Choosing a Quality Magnesium Threonate Supplement
- Prioritize Verified Purity
Choose magnesium threonate supplements that provide certificates of analysis from third-party labs, such as NSF International or USP, to confirm magnesium content and exclude contaminants.
- Check for Bioavailability
Focus on products listing “magnesium L-threonate” (MgT) as the primary active ingredient—examples include branded forms like Magtein—to ensure targeted absorption into the brain.
- Evaluate Dosage Options
Select supplements offering tablets or capsules containing 500–1,000 mg per serving to allow flexible dosing within Huberman’s recommended 1,000–2,000 mg daily intake.
- Scan for Additives
Avoid supplements with unnecessary fillers, artificial colors, or sweeteners to minimize potential digestive irritation and allergen risks.
- Review Company Reputation
Research brands with transparent sourcing, clear labeling, and consistent user reviews on platforms such as Labdoor, Amazon, or ConsumerLab to reduce the risk of low-quality products.
- Consider Allergen and Dietary Factors
Seek allergen-free, gluten-free, or vegan magnesium threonate if you have dietary restrictions or sensitivities.

Frequently Asked Questions
What is magnesium threonate and how does it benefit brain health?
Magnesium threonate is a unique form of magnesium that effectively crosses the blood-brain barrier, increasing brain magnesium levels. This helps enhance memory, focus, cognitive function, and overall brain health, as supported by Dr. Andrew Huberman’s research.
How does magnesium threonate differ from other magnesium supplements?
Unlike other forms such as magnesium citrate or glycinate, magnesium threonate is specifically designed to deliver magnesium directly to the brain. This unique property supports synaptic functioning, memory, and neural plasticity more effectively.
What daily dosage of magnesium threonate does Dr. Huberman recommend?
Dr. Huberman suggests a daily dose of 1,000–2,000 mg of magnesium threonate, divided into two or three smaller doses for better absorption and to reduce digestive discomfort. Dosages may be adjusted based on individual needs and tolerances.
When is the best time to take magnesium threonate for optimal results?
Optimal results are achieved when magnesium threonate is taken 1–2 hours before bedtime or later in the evening. Some users prefer splitting the dosage, using part in the day for cognitive benefits and part before sleep to improve rest.
Can magnesium threonate improve sleep quality?
Yes, magnesium threonate may improve sleep by promoting relaxation, reducing brain hyperactivity, and supporting deeper, more restful sleep. However, responses to its sleep-promoting effects can vary from person to person.
What are the possible side effects of magnesium threonate?
Side effects are usually limited to mild digestive discomfort, such as bloating or loose stools, especially at higher doses. Splitting the dosage or reducing the amount taken at once can help minimize these effects.
Are there any drug interactions with magnesium threonate?
Yes, magnesium threonate can interact with certain medications like antibiotics and bisphosphonates. If you take prescription medications, consult your healthcare provider before starting magnesium threonate.
Is magnesium threonate safe during pregnancy or breastfeeding?
Currently, there is not enough robust data to support the safety of magnesium threonate during pregnancy or breastfeeding. Consult your doctor before use in these situations.
What should I look for when choosing a magnesium threonate supplement?
Choose supplements with third-party lab certificates, list “magnesium L-threonate” as the active ingredient, offer flexible dosages, and contain minimal additives or fillers. Also, consider the manufacturer’s reputation and check for allergens if you have sensitivities.
Who should avoid magnesium threonate supplementation?
Individuals with kidney issues or those taking medications that interact with magnesium should avoid it unless advised by a healthcare professional. If you have health concerns, always consult your doctor before adding new supplements.
